- [ ] Step 7: Archive cold storage buckets (Glacierline tier). Confirm both ceremony witnesses are present, verify bucket manifests match the Oxbow ledger, then seal the archive key shares. Plugin authors may observe but not handle shares. Once sealed, the archive index itself is encrypted and can only be reopened with the passphrase below.

vault phrase of badup-hahig = tamael-aldael-kelmir-istael-fenok-istwyn-tamius-jorath-oliion

## Deploying the Gatewick Proctor Queue

Deploys are pretty painless: push to main, wait for the pipeline, then watch the queue drain dashboard for five minutes. If candidates pile up mid-exam, roll back first and ask questions later — the queue replays safely. Everything the workers care about lives in one config block, shown here for reference.

settings of bafof-yagef:
JOROX_PIN=8740
JOROX_TENANT=pelox
JOROX_METRICS_HOST=metrics.jorox.qorvelworks.internal
JOROX_SEAL=seal_c78f63c1
JOROX_STANDBY_TEAM=norax

Subject: Proposed Move to Annual Billing

Executive team,

After reviewing three quarters of renewal data, Finance recommends shifting Lumivent's default contracts from monthly to annual billing, effective next fiscal year. Sales leads should note: existing monthly customers will be grandfathered for twelve months, and discount authority will be capped at 8% without VP sign-off. Rollout materials are in draft with Dario Fensk. The board-level reasoning behind this change appears directly below.

internal memo for yahap-badug: Headcount on the Zorys team goes from 28 to 129 by the end of March. Gross margin on Zorys came in at 40 percent against a plan of 48 percent.

Ticket — Facilities Desk. Heads up: while Drayfield House is being renovated, we're operating out of the temporary site at Unit 4, Cobblers Yard. Printers and post room are up; meeting rooms are first-come. The side door sticks, so give it a shove. Door access for the temp site uses the code below.

staff pass of kawip-hawef = bdg-QLP-2